Microstructure of SANY ANGKAITAI, a Three Colors Mixed Glaze

Abstract: By means of SEM, TEM, ESA, EDX and POM, changes in microstructure of three colors mixed samples fired at different temperatures have been studied. The results of stud­ies show that in the sample Langyao red glaze there do exist some proportion of Cu20 and Cu crystals; when the temperature is on the low side or when reducing atmospohere is too weak, the white crystals separated out from the glaze surface are exwollastonites; its mirror black glaze is also a liquid-phase separate one, the diameter of isolated liquid drop is about 20nm and evenly distributed in glaze layers, thus resultting in increase of refracion and absorption of light and improvement, of its color generation ability.

Keywords: glaze, copper red, microstructure
